People and Culture Manager Courses in Orange

A People and Culture Manager leads HR strategies to attract talent, develop policies, and ensure effective employee engagement and performance reporting.

Average salaries for HR Professionals in Australia, including People and Culture Managers, are currently $2,000 per week ($104,000 annually). These are median figures for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only.

There are no clear employment figures for People and Culture Managers working in Australia at this time. They are employed in the HR departments of large corporations, SMEs, non-profits, and government agencies across all industries and employment sectors.

People and Culture Managers in Australia have university qualifications in business administration, human resources, employment relations, or psychology. Examples include: Bachelor of Business (Employment Relations), Bachelor of Business (Human Resource Management), Bachelor of Psychological Science (Human Resources) and Master of Business Administration (People and Culture).
